English (LSJ)

ἡ,

   A inhospitality, Eratosth. ap. Str.17.1.19, D.S.1.67.

German (Pape)

[Seite 269] ἡ, Ungastlichkeit, Strab.

Greek (Liddell-Scott)

ἀξενία: ἡ, ἔλλειψις φιλοξενίας, Ἐρατοσθ. παρὰ Στράβ. 802.

Spanish (DGE)

-ας, ἡ
falta de hospitalidadde un lugar, Eratosth.Fr.Geog.1B.9, de pers., D.S.1.67.
